A reputable law firm in Nottingham is seeking a Legal Administrator for their Family and Children Law department. The role requires strong administrative and organizational skills, and previous legal experience is preferred, though training will be provided.

Responsibilities include:

  • Processing legal aid applications
  • Managing diaries
  • Liaising with clients and professionals

This is a full-time, office-based position with standard hours from Monday to Friday.
